2. Evaluation Program Architectures
The structural layout of a prop firm's evaluation suite dictates how easily a trader can match their individual strategy—whether day trading, scalping, or position trading—to a funded model.
The5ers Program Portfolio
The5ers operates four distinct pathways designed for different capital requirements and risk profiles:
- High Stakes Program: A classic two-stage evaluation pathway targeting disciplined growth. Phase 1 requires an 8% profit target, while Phase 2 requires a 5% target. Maximum daily drawdown is set at 5%, paired with a 10% maximum trailing drawdown limit. Upon reaching funded status, profit splits begin at 80% and scale up to 100% as milestone targets are achieved.
- Hyper Growth Program: A one-step evaluation route where traders qualify after reaching a single profit target (typically 10%). It is tailored for traders seeking direct progression without completing two separate testing phases. Once qualified, the account doubles capital allocation at every 10% net gain.
- Bootcamp Program: Designed for cost-conscious traders, Bootcamp allows entry into a 3-stage simulated challenge for a lower initial registration fee. Full challenge fees are paid only after passing the initial evaluation phases, leading into funded stages up to $250K or higher.
- Futures Program: Offers Day Trade and Swing evaluation paths specifically structured around exchange-traded derivatives rules, featuring End-of-Day (EOD) loss limits and consistency parameters.
E8 Markets Evaluation Framework
E8 Markets structures its primary offerings around the E8 Account and E8 Track series, supplemented by proprietary account customization options:
- E8 Account (2-Step): The core challenge requiring an 8% Phase 1 profit target and a 4% to 5% Phase 2 profit target. It features a maximum drawdown system (often around 8%–10%) and daily equity loss controls.
- E8 Track (3-Step): A three-stage evaluation designed to lower overall risk exposure during the initial stages. Target requirements are spread across three phases (e.g., 5% / 5% / 5%), offering lower entry fees in exchange for additional testing steps.
- Customizable Dashboard Parameters: E8 Markets allows traders to adjust specific rules during checkout, such as choosing static drawdown models, higher payout splits, or altered leverage caps, altering the base challenge price accordingly.
3. Drawdown Engine & Risk Rules
Drawdown mechanics are arguably the single most critical factor in determining whether a trading system can survive an evaluation. A firm with rigid trailing equity drawdown presents vastly different risk math than one offering static balance-based limits.
Key Distinction: Static vs. High-Water Mark Trailing Drawdown
Static drawdown remains tied to initial balance or fixed equity thresholds, giving open positions room to breathe as your account grows. Trailing drawdown moves upward with peak equity, locking in profits but narrowing the allowable buffer during pullback phases.
Mathematical Breakdown: Daily vs. Maximum Loss Limits
Let's illustrate how drawdown calculation methods impact open positions in a $100,000 simulated account across both models.
| Scenario Parameter | Static / Fixed Max Drawdown (10%) | Equity Peak Trailing Drawdown (8%) |
|---|---|---|
| Starting Balance | $100,000 | $100,000 |
| Peak Account Equity Reached | $108,000 | $108,000 |
| Minimum Breach Threshold | $90,000 (Fixed relative to starting balance) | $100,000 (Trails peak equity of $108,000 minus 8%) |
| Available Pullback Margin | $18,000 open equity drop allowed before breach | $8,000 open equity drop allowed before breach |
In The5ers High Stakes program, daily risk is computed based on initial day equity or balance, maintaining clear, defined risk boundaries. In E8 Markets , depending on whether a trader selects standard or customized terms, the maximum drawdown engine may trail equity until original capital is protected or remain locked to a balance floor.

Refund Mechanics
Both firms generally offer fee refunds upon successful completion of evaluation phases and the first successful profit payout on funded accounts. However, if an account breaches maximum or daily drawdown rules during any phase, entry fees are non-refundable.
5. Profit Splits & Withdrawal Logistics
Generating simulated trading profits is only meaningful if withdrawal policies are straightforward, reliable, and backed by flexible settlement rails.
Profit Split Scaling
The5ers: Standard evaluations start at an 80% profit split. As traders hit performance milestones (e.g., reaching 10% net gain targets consistently), the profit split scales upward to 85%, 90%, and ultimately 100% on select scaling tiers, alongside capital increases up to $500,000+.
E8 Markets: Standard evaluations offer an 80% default profit split. Through add-on selections during checkout or consistent payout history, traders can unlock 90% split tiers. Scaling frameworks allow account size adjustments based on quarterly performance metrics.
Withdrawal Methods & Processing Schedules
| Payout Parameter | The5ers | E8 Markets |
|---|---|---|
| First Payout Eligibility | 14 days after first trade on funded stage (or on-demand depending on tier) | 8 to 14 days after initial funded trade execution |
| Payout Cycle Frequency | Bi-weekly / On-demand options on advanced stages | Bi-weekly standard schedule; custom add-ons available |
| Supported Withdrawal Channels | Deel, Bank Wire, Crypto (USDT, BTC) | Rise, Deel, Bank Wire, Cryptocurrency options |
| Minimum Withdrawal Amount | Low minimum threshold (typically $20–$100 depending on processor) | Varies by payout processor selected |
6. Trading Permissions & Asset Classes
A firm's rulebook determines which trading styles are compatible with their platforms. Constraints on news trading, weekend holding, or automated systems (EAs) can significantly impact mechanical or swing trading strategies.
Holding Over Weekends and News Events
- The5ers: Weekend holding and overnight positions are permitted across most major programs, making it an attractive destination for swing traders. High-impact news trading is permitted on many tiers, though traders must review program guidelines regarding opening orders within 2 minutes before/after major economic announcements on specific high-leverage accounts.
- E8 Markets: Allows weekend holding and overnight trades on standard account structures. News trading is generally permitted during evaluation phases, but traders are advised to consult updated terms regarding news execution windows during funded stages.
EA and Copy Trading Rules
The5ers: Expert Advisors (EAs) and automated trading bots are permitted provided they do not execute arbitrage, latency manipulation, tick scalping, or account-sharing strategies across multiple users. Each trader must run unique or customized parameters.
E8 Markets: Permits EAs and automated trading algorithms under similar fair-use guidelines. Copy trading between your own personal accounts is allowed, but cross-account copying between different user accounts is strictly prohibited.
